    General Duty Assistant (GDA) Course Overview

    The General Duty Assistant (GDA) course is designed to train individuals to provide basic care and support to patients in hospitals, nursing homes, and clinics. GDAs play a crucial role in assisting nurses and doctors, ensuring that patients receive the best possible care. This course equips students with the necessary skills to perform tasks such as maintaining hygiene, ensuring patient comfort, and assisting with mobility and daily activities. GDAs are essential members of the healthcare team, contributing to the smooth operation of medical facilities and ensuring patients’ well-being.


    • Course: General Duty Assistant

    • Duration: 1 Year

    • Eligibility: After 10th Pass

    Core Subjects:

    • Basics of Patient Care
    • Personal Hygiene and Sanitation
    • First Aid and Basic Life Support
    • Patient Mobility and Transfer Techniques
    • Communication Skills and Empathy in Care
    • Infection Control and Cleanliness
    • Nutrition and Diet Planning for Patients

    Career Opportunities for General Duty Assistants

    After completing the GDA course, you will be qualified for various roles in the healthcare industry, including:

    • General Duty Assistant: Provide basic care and assistance to patients in hospitals, ensuring their comfort and supporting the medical staff.
    • Home Care Assistant: Offer in-home care services for elderly or bedridden patients, assisting with their daily routines and providing companionship.
    • Ward Assistant: Work in hospital wards, supporting nurses and ensuring a hygienic and well-organized environment.
    • Patient Care Attendant: Assist in patient care in rehabilitation centers, old age homes, and nursing homes.
    • Emergency Room Assistant: Support the medical team in emergency rooms by providing first aid and assisting with patient transfers and care.

    Importance of General Duty Assistants in Healthcare

    GDAs play a vital role in the healthcare system by providing direct care and support to patients. They act as a bridge between the patients and the medical staff, ensuring that patients’ needs are met efficiently. The presence of skilled GDAs in hospitals and care facilities helps in:

    • Improving Patient Comfort: GDAs ensure that patients are comfortable during their stay by attending to their basic needs.
    • Reducing the Burden on Nurses: By assisting with routine tasks, GDAs allow nurses to focus more on clinical responsibilities and specialized care.
    • Enhancing Patient Experience: The compassionate care provided by GDAs makes a significant difference in the overall patient experience, especially for those who are elderly or disabled.
    • Supporting Family Members: GDAs offer relief to families by providing professional care to their loved ones, ensuring their safety and well-being.
